Understanding CNC Mills for Beginners
CNC mills automate material removal using computer-guided movements, processing workpieces such as aluminium, brass, and polymers. Entry-level models prioritise ease of use, integrating touchscreen interfaces and clear prompts to simplify setup. Machines like the Genmitsu PROVerXL and Carbide 3D Shapeoko offer guided workflow for first-time users. Safety features, including enclosed workspaces and automatic tool shut-off, protect operators.
Specification tables for beginner CNC mills list crucial factors:
Feature | Typical Range | Example Models |
---|---|---|
Working Area (mm) | 300 x 180 to 800 x 800 | Genmitsu PROVerXL, Shapeoko 4 |
Spindle Power (W) | 150 to 1000 | FoxAlien CNC Router, SainSmart 4030 |
Supported Materials | Wood, Plastic, Soft Metals | All entry-level desktop mills |
Operating System Compatibility | Windows, macOS, Linux | Carbide Create, GRBL |
Assembled/Kit | Pre-assembled, DIY kit | BobsCNC Evolution, SainSmart |
Software compatibility impacts workflow efficiency. Entry models support G-code files, generated by applications like Fusion 360 and Easel, providing flexibility for different project types. USB and SD card inputs enable simple file transfer.
Accessories such as clamping kits, dust shoes, and probe sensors extend capability for beginners. Manufacturers and third-party suppliers offer these for brands like Genmitsu and SainSmart.
Maintenance for beginner CNC mills involves routine checks of drive belts, lubrication for moving axes, and periodic firmware updates. User manuals provide step-by-step guidance for these tasks.
Options for beginners in the UK market include support and training via forums, YouTube channels, and official technical resources, reducing the learning curve when starting CNC milling projects.
Key Features to Consider When Choosing a CNC Mill

Selecting the right CNC mill for beginners requires careful assessment of core features. The size, build quality, interface, software compatibility, pricing structure, and user support all influence both the user experience and long-term satisfaction.
Size and Build Quality
Machine footprint and durability play key roles in entry-level CNC mill selection. Compact units, such as those from Tormach, support small workshop layouts and fit limited bench space. Robust metal frames and precision-finished slides, seen in models like the HAAS Mini Mill, ensure consistent accuracy over repeated use. A rigid structure reduces vibration, yielding greater precision for materials such as aluminium or plastics. Build quality also determines maintenance intervals and the lifespan of key movement components, like leadscrews and linear guides, keeping operation stable.
Control Systems and Software Compatibility
User interfaces and software compatibility affect operational ease for new users. HAAS machines provide intuitive controls with clear menu systems, minimising the learning curve. Compatibility with established CAM software, such as Fusion 360 and Easel, increases workflow flexibility for design and machining operations. Look for USB connectivity, touchscreen options, and support for standard G-code files, as supported by Tormach and other entry models. Efficient data transfer, paired with software updates and error correction, helps ensure reliable performance for a broad range of prototype designs.
Cost and Value for Money
Initial purchase price, ongoing maintenance costs, and available upgrades shape the overall value of beginner CNC mills. Tormach entry models deliver a balance of affordability and feature set, making them suitable for personal and small business budgets. Consider package inclusions, such as starter toolkits or basic enclosure systems, when comparing costs. Budget-friendly options might omit advanced features, but essential functions—like a stable spindle, accessory mounts, and calibration tools—must deliver consistent outputs. Upgradability influences long-term value, enabling expansion as user experience grows.
Support and Community Resources
Active support infrastructure streamlines troubleshooting and skill development. HAAS offers comprehensive documentation and responsive technical assistance, reducing downtime during learning. Community forums and user groups, active around Tormach and HAAS platforms, enable fast peer-to-peer guidance on setup or toolpath problems. Video tutorials, downloadable guides, and online training cover frequent beginner queries, improving project outcomes. Machines supported by training resources and a responsive community reduce learning barriers, giving new users the confidence to progress quickly in CNC milling.
Top CNC Mills Recommended for Beginners

Selecting the right CNC mill helps beginners achieve accurate, repeatable results with minimal frustration. Entry-level and benchtop machines cater to new users keen on exploring fabrication in small workshops or home environments.
Entry-Level Desktop CNC Mills
Entry-level desktop CNC mills feature compact designs suitable for home or prototyping use. Tormach’s Desktop CNC includes a 15.8″ x 12″ x 5.3“ work area, integrated CAM software, and optional 4-axis support, enabling precise machining in metals, plastics, and wood. MYSWEETY 3018 Pro, a budget 3-axis unit, offers a 160 x 100 x 45 mm area, handles acrylic, PVC, and wood, and supports upgrades including limit switches and enhanced control boards. Roland MDX-50 provides automated workflows, high-precision cuts, and broad material support for metals, plastic, and wood, appealing to users seeking easy setup and professional-level accuracy.
Benchtop and Hobbyist CNC Mills
Benchtop and hobbyist CNC mills meet the requirements of users seeking robust construction and customisation. Ooznest Workbee stands out with modular sizes (from 500 to 1500 mm), open-source design, and capability to mill foam, wood, plastics, and aluminium. Denford and Boxford models, frequently sourced second-hand, deliver reliability and durability for wood and soft metals, making them economical options for beginners. These solutions offer straightforward assembly, accessible motion control, and longevity, supporting DIY, educational, and prototype projects.
Comparison of Popular Beginner Models
Comparing leading beginner CNC mills highlights differences in build, capability, and budget. Tormach models command a high price but bring integrated CAM software and 4-axis potential, supporting a wide range of materials with industrial-grade results. MYSWEETY 3018 Pro, positioned for affordability, limits material choice but benefits from upgradability and GRBL compatibility. Ooznest Workbee provides moderate pricing, open-source hardware, and broad material handling, while Roland MDX-50 leads on automation and precision but at a higher cost. Denford and Boxford, often acquired used, minimise costs and maintain robust performance for entry-level wood and metal projects.
Model | Work Area | Materials | Price Range | Key Features |
---|---|---|---|---|
Tormach | 15.8″ x 12″ x 5.3″ | Metals, plastics, wood | High | Integrated CAM, 4-axis option |
MYSWEETY 3018 Pro | 160 x 100 x 45 mm | Acrylic, wood, PVC | Low | Upgradable, GRBL control |
Ooznest Workbee | 500-1500 mm | Foam, wood, aluminium | Moderate | Open-source, modular sizes |
Roland MDX-50 | Varies | Metals, wood, plastics | High | Automated, precision |
Denford/Boxford | Varies | Wood, soft metals | Low (used) | Robust, ex-educational |
Tips for Getting Started with Your First CNC Mill
Beginner CNC mill owners achieve reliable results when they prioritise safe set-up, efficient calibration, and select essential accessories before machining. With clear routines and key upgrades, they’re prepared to maximise machine capability and minimise downtime.
Setting Up Safely and Efficiently
Proper CNC mill set-up for beginners relies on strict safety and process routines. Operators use protective equipment like safety goggles and gloves to shield against debris and sharp parts. Clamping workpieces firmly, they stabilise materials before activating the spindle, preventing slips and ensuring accuracy. Ventilated workspaces remove dust and fumes, especially during plastics or wood milling. Owners start with soft materials like wood or acrylic for software calibration, then move to metals such as aluminium once feed rates and spindle speed are dialled in. Lubricating leadscrews and bearings weekly maintains smooth axis travel, with dust covers preventing swarf build-up on rails and motors.
Essential Accessories and Upgrades
Critical CNC mill accessories and upgrades improve performance and workflow for entry-level machines. Carbide end mills in 1–3mm diameters cut crisp details in wood, acrylic, or PCB blanks. Compatible software options such as Candle and Easel streamline G-code generation and remote job monitoring, suited to USB and web-based setups. After-market limit switches improve position accuracy, reducing errors in multi-step jobs. Adding dust extraction systems protects electronics and extends component life. Beginners select kits that include clear assembly guides and support, with ready access to replacement tooling and parts for uninterrupted production. These additions give operators more control during complex cuts and increase overall productivity from the first project.

Frequently Asked Questions
What is a CNC mill and how does it work?
A CNC mill is a computer-controlled machine that shapes materials like metal and plastic with high precision. It works by following programmed instructions (G-code) to move cutting tools and remove material, creating complex parts automatically and accurately.
What should beginners look for in a CNC mill?
Beginners should prioritise user-friendly interfaces, reliable performance, solid build quality, compatibility with popular software, and essential safety features. These factors help ensure a smooth learning curve and better results from the start.
Why is software compatibility important for CNC mills?
Software compatibility ensures efficient workflow, allowing users to design parts and generate the correct G-code. Most entry-level CNC mills support widely-used programs like Fusion 360 and Easel, which simplifies the process for beginners.
Are there safety concerns when using a CNC mill?
Yes, safety is crucial. Beginners should choose mills with enclosed workspaces, emergency stop buttons, and automatic tool shut-off. Always wear protective equipment and follow the manufacturer’s guidelines to operate the machine safely.
How do I maintain an entry-level CNC mill?
Routine checks of drive belts, regular lubrication of moving parts, firmware updates, and following the user manual’s maintenance instructions will keep a beginner CNC mill running efficiently and prolong its life.
What are good beginner CNC mill models?
Recommended beginner CNC mills include the Tormach Desktop CNC, MYSWEETY 3018 Pro, Roland MDX-50, and benchtop models like Ooznest Workbee. These machines offer ease of use, sturdy construction, and good software support.
Can a beginner CNC mill handle metals?
Many entry-level CNC mills can machine softer metals like aluminium and brass, but it’s best to start with plastics or wood until you’re comfortable with the settings and techniques. Always check the supported materials in the machine’s specifications.
What accessories should beginners consider?
Useful accessories include carbide end mills, clamping kits, dust shoes, and limit switches. These enhance performance, improve safety, and make the milling process smoother and more efficient for newcomers.
Where can beginners find support and training in the UK?
Beginners can access support through online forums, YouTube channels, and official manufacturer resources. Many UK suppliers provide guides, tutorials, and active user communities for troubleshooting and skill development.
How much should I budget for a beginner CNC mill?
Prices for beginner CNC mills vary, typically ranging from £250 for basic models to £2,000 for more advanced benchtop units. Consider the total cost, including software, accessories, and potential upgrades, to get the best value for your needs.
